About Highland, IN
Highland skews on age — the median resident is 44.5, older than the national median. With 23,749 residents, Highland is a city in Indiana. It ranks #42 among cities in Indiana by population.
The typical household here earns about $76,219, near the US median of $78,538. About 6.9% of residents live below the federal poverty level, below the national 12.4%. Housing is relatively affordable, with a median home value of $219,500, with typical rent around $1,202.
Roughly 30.1% of adults have a bachelor’s, below the national 35.0%. Just 6.9% of workers are home-based, below the national 14.0%, and the average commute runs about 26 minutes each way.

Highland town Population History (2010-2024)
The city of Highland town had a population of 23,718 in 2010 and 23,497 in 2024, a -0.9% growth over 14 years. The peak was 23,962 in 2020. Average annual growth rate: -0.05%.

Highland town, IN Climate
Highland town, IN has an average annual temperature of 10°C (50°F) and receives about 965 mm of precipitation per year. The warmest month is July and the coldest is January. Figures are 1970–2000 climate normals.
